Artist: puressence
Song: don't know any better
Well I'm coming home again
on a future missing plane
and there's water on the window
a message in the rain

Just when I thought all was lost
nothing could describe it
If you' re fighting for a cause
nobody should hide it

Here's my excuse, here's my excuse
and I don't know any better
who do you lose, who do you lose
when you don't know any better

Well I'm driving home again
try to lose the pain she gain
and the radio explains
someone else just took my place

Here's my excuse, here's my excuse
and I don't know any better
Falling for you, falling for you
cause I don't know any better

You think we are all the same..
You think I'll never change..
